GWM (Great Wall Motors) Jolion is a compact crossover SUV that continues to cause waves in the Kenyan market thanks to its exceptional value and seamless blend of style, safety features, technology, and practicality. Produced under the Haval marque, the Jolion largely appeals to the young clientele who are after optics and performance. Jolion nameplate is derived from the Chinese word “Chulian” meaning first love. The Haval Jolion fits in every sense from fuel efficiency, agility, and compactness for folks who reside in the metropolis. Despite its excellent perks, it competes with the Toyota Corolla Cross, Kia Seltos, MG ZS, Hyundai Kona, Mazda CX-30, Nissan Qashqai, Honda HR-V, Subaru XV, and Mitsubishi ASX.

Daihatsu Tanto’s widespread popularity in urban areas is attributed to its excellent fuel economy, practicality, and innovative space-saving features. It is small from the outside but very roomy once you step into the cabin. Its agility and compactness allow it to easily maneuver in confined spaces or in traffic hence its high numbers in the metropolis. The best part of this car is its affordable acquisition cost which will cater to individuals on a tight budget. It competes with the Suzuki Spacia, Honda N Box, Nissan Dayz, and Mitsubishi eK Wagon.

The 2020 Honda N Box is out to outperform the likes of Suzuki Spacia, Daihatsu Tanto, Nissan Dayz, and Mitsubishi eK Wagon as the best-selling compact car in Kenya. You might be forgiven for dismissing it as a boxy car on wheels until you get to experience the cabin’s great features and its refined driving experience that will save your pockets from running dry. Its nimble handling and compactness make it ideal for city driving. The boxy shape of the N Box might not be everyone’s cup of tea but it stands out from the crowd not forgetting to mention the spacious interior and practicality you enjoy. Its only drawback is that it’s not meant for long-distance driving owing to its small powertrain.
